The PIC32MX575F512H-80I/PT is a microcontroller from the PIC32 family, manufactured by Microchip Technology Inc. It is a high-performance 32-bit microcontroller based on the MIPS32 core, designed for a wide range of embedded control and processing applications.
Here are some key features and specifications of the PIC32MX575F512H-80I/PT microcontroller:
1. Microcontroller Core: The PIC32MX575F512H-80I/PT is based on the 32-bit MIPS32 M4K core, providing a high level of performance and processing capabilities.
2. CPU Speed: The microcontroller operates at a maximum CPU speed of 80 MHz, allowing for fast execution of instructions and efficient processing of data.
3. Flash Memory: It features 512KB of Flash memory for program storage, enabling the implementation of complex applications and firmware.
4. RAM: The microcontroller has 64KB of RAM for data storage, facilitating efficient data processing and manipulation.
5. Peripherals: The PIC32MX575F512H-80I/PT includes a wide range of integrated peripherals, such as GPIO (General Purpose Input/Output), timers, UART (Universal Asynchronous Receiver/Transmitter), SPI (Serial Peripheral Interface), I2C (Inter-Integrated Circuit), ADC (Analog-to-Digital Converter), and more, providing versatile interfacing capabilities.
6. Communication Interfaces: The microcontroller supports various communication interfaces, including USB (Universal Serial Bus), Ethernet, CAN (Controller Area Network), and more, making it suitable for communication-intensive applications.
7. Operating Voltage: The microcontroller typically operates at a supply voltage of 3.3V.
8. Package Type: The "/PT" in the part number indicates the package type, which is a TQFP (Thin Quad Flat Package), a surface-mount package suitable for most applications.
